3. Ricotta High quality
The standard of ricotta cheese straight and considerably impacts the general success of a cavatelli preparation. Ricotta, that means “recooked” in Italian, is a recent cheese created from whey, a byproduct of cheesemaking. Inferior ricotta, usually mass-produced, lacks the creamy texture and delicate sweetness that outline high-quality variations. The sensible consequence is a much less flavorful and fewer satisfying dish. For instance, utilizing ricotta created from skim milk ends in a dry, grainy texture that contrasts sharply with the specified easy consistency, diminishing the meant expertise. In distinction, high-quality ricotta, sometimes created from entire milk or a mixture of entire milk and cream, gives the mandatory richness and moisture to bind the pasta and different elements.
The supply and processing strategies additional affect the result. Ricotta di pecora, created from sheep’s milk, affords a richer, extra advanced taste profile in comparison with cow’s milk ricotta. Conventional strategies of manufacturing, involving gradual heating and cautious draining, protect the cheese’s delicate texture and pure sweetness. Industrially produced ricotta, subjected to fast processing and the addition of stabilizers, usually suffers a lack of taste and textural integrity. The implication is {that a} dish utilizing artisanal ricotta is prone to exhibit better depth of taste and a extra luxurious mouthfeel, elevating the general sensory expertise. 4. Herb Choice
The choice of herbs exerts a discernible affect on the flavour profile of cavatelli with ricotta. Herbs contribute fragrant compounds and nuanced flavors that both complement or distinction the inherent traits of the pasta and cheese. The absence of rigorously thought of herb choice ends in a dish that lacks complexity and fragrant curiosity. For instance, a preparation incorporating solely salt and pepper, whereas acceptable, fails to realize the depth of taste attainable with recent herbs. The selection of herb, due to this fact, constitutes a crucial ingredient in shaping the ultimate gustatory expertise.
Particular herbs supply distinct pairings. Recent basil, with its candy, barely peppery notes, harmonizes successfully with the creamy texture of ricotta. Parsley, offering a clear, grassy taste, features as a palate cleanser, stopping the dish from changing into overly wealthy. Sage, notably when browned in butter, introduces an earthy, savory counterpoint to the sweetness of the ricotta. These examples reveal the sensible significance of herb choice, exhibiting how particular decisions can improve or alter the general impression of the cavatelli dish. 5. Cooking Time
Optimum cooking time represents a crucial variable within the preparation of cavatelli with ricotta, influencing each the pasta’s texture and the general integration of flavors inside the dish. Inadequate cooking yields a pasta that’s unpleasantly agency and proof against the chew, stopping satisfactory absorption of the ricotta sauce. Conversely, extreme cooking ends in a mushy, unappetizing texture and a lack of the pasta’s structural integrity, diminishing the meant mouthfeel. For instance, boiling cavatelli for 5 minutes when the advisable time is twelve will go away the pasta undercooked, whereas extending the cooking time to twenty minutes will seemingly end in a gummy texture. The right cooking time, due to this fact, is crucial for attaining the specified al dente consistency, characterised by a slight resistance to the tooth and a pleasing chewiness.
The perfect cooking period is influenced by components akin to the kind of cavatelli (recent versus dried), the altitude at which the pasta is cooked, and the depth of the warmth supply. Recent pasta sometimes requires a shorter cooking time in comparison with dried pasta, on account of its larger moisture content material. Excessive altitudes necessitate barely longer cooking occasions, as water boils at a decrease temperature. Furthermore, the suitable cooking time varies relying on the specified degree of doneness. Some cooks choose a barely firmer texture, whereas others choose a extra tender consequence. In sensible phrases, common tasting in the course of the cooking course of is crucial for figuring out the exact second when the pasta reaches the specified al dente state. A sensible software includes initiating style assessments roughly two minutes earlier than the producer’s advisable cooking time, permitting for a gradual evaluation of the pasta’s texture.

7. Salt Stability
Salt stability constitutes a crucial ingredient within the preparation of cavatelli with ricotta, profoundly affecting the dish’s general taste profile and perceived palatability. Inadequate salting ends in a bland and underdeveloped style, whereas extreme salting overwhelms the opposite elements, rendering the dish unpleasantly harsh. Subsequently, attaining optimum salt stability is crucial for enhancing the inherent flavors of the pasta, cheese, and different elements.
-
Pasta Water Salinity
The salinity of the water used to cook dinner the pasta straight influences the flavour of the cavatelli itself. Salting the water adequately permits the pasta to soak up salt throughout cooking, seasoning it from the within out. As a rule of thumb, the water needs to be as salty as seawater. Failure to salt the pasta water sufficiently ends in a bland base that can’t be totally compensated for by including salt to the sauce. This course of ensures the salt is uniformly distributed.
-
Ricotta Seasoning
Ricotta cheese, notably recent ricotta, possesses a light taste profile that advantages from the addition of salt. The salt enhances the ricotta’s pure sweetness and balances its creamy texture. Nevertheless, over-salting the ricotta can simply overpower its delicate taste. Cautious, incremental seasoning is due to this fact obligatory to realize the specified stability. Salt additionally has a task within the texture of the cheese, so including salt might change texture in recent ricotta.

Continuously Requested Questions
This part addresses widespread inquiries relating to the preparation and understanding of cavatelli with ricotta, aiming to offer clear and informative solutions to boost culinary information.
Query 1: What constitutes “high-quality” ricotta cheese?
Excessive-quality ricotta is characterised by a creamy, easy texture and a subtly candy taste. It’s sometimes created from entire milk or a mixture of entire milk and cream. Keep away from ricotta that’s dry, grainy, or overly acidic.
Query 2: Can dried cavatelli pasta be substituted for recent?
Whereas dried cavatelli pasta can be utilized, recent pasta is most well-liked on account of its superior texture and talent to soak up sauce extra successfully. Alter cooking time accordingly based mostly on the pasta sort used.
Query 3: What are appropriate herb options for basil?
If basil is unavailable, parsley, oregano, or thyme can function acceptable substitutes, although every will impart a definite taste profile. Take into account the specified fragrant end result when choosing another.
Query 4: How can one forestall the ricotta sauce from changing into too thick?
To stop a thick sauce, reserve some pasta water throughout cooking and steadily add it to the ricotta combination till the specified consistency is achieved. The starch within the pasta water aids in emulsification.
Query 5: Is it essential to salt the pasta water?
Sure, salting the pasta water is crucial. The pasta absorbs salt throughout cooking, seasoning it from inside. The water needs to be as salty as seawater for optimum taste.
Query 6: What’s the optimum serving temperature?
Cavatelli with ricotta is finest served heat. This temperature enhances the creaminess of the ricotta, permits the olive oil’s aromatics to be expressed, and promotes general taste integration.

Cavatelli with Ricotta Recipe Ideas
This part gives actionable insights to boost the preparation of cavatelli with ricotta, specializing in methods that enhance taste, texture, and general culinary end result.
Tip 1: Pre-warm Serving Bowls: Warming the serving bowls previous to plating helps keep the dish’s temperature, stopping fast cooling and preserving the ricotta’s creamy texture.
Tip 2: Grate Cheese Tableside: Providing freshly grated Parmesan or Pecorino Romano tableside permits diners to customise the saltiness and improve the dish’s fragrant complexity in line with private desire.
Tip 3: Brown Butter Sage Infusion: Infusing brown butter with recent sage earlier than combining it with the pasta and ricotta introduces a nutty, savory depth to the sauce.
Tip 4: Use Excessive-High quality Olive Oil as a Ending Drizzle: Drizzling a small quantity of high-quality further virgin olive oil over the plated dish enhances its richness and provides a refined peppery notice.
Tip 5: Incorporate Toasted Breadcrumbs for Texture: Including toasted breadcrumbs gives a contrasting textural ingredient, enhancing the dish’s general mouthfeel and including a refined crunch.
Tip 6: Do not overcook Cavatelli. Sustaining an “al dente” texture of the pasta provides distinction to the delicate texture of cheese. It additionally provides a constructive element to your expertise.
Tip 7: Use full fats ricotta. Do not attempt to spare energy on this cheese. Half skim won’t render the identical deliciousness as entire milk or cream ricotta.
